Output 99df2430ef62229d262f63f72b91b2877a7e91c860ea0eed26fb5a715dda2404:1

value
1084000091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 188a7fed0fe0b4719d22628be36dd51e95907edd OP_EQUALVERIFY OP_CHECKSIG
address
13Em8jVKhJAb4uWSW93HWvXo7GRZpv6o2j
transaction
99df2430ef62229d262f63f72b91b2877a7e91c860ea0eed26fb5a715dda2404
spent
true